Dogs star responds to coach’s sobering warning amid failed trade fallout

Western Bulldogs star Josh Dunkley has conceded he isnt playing his best footy and admitted the desire for more midfield minutes played a part in his decision to request a trade to Essendon last year.
Dunkleys request to head to the Bombers was one of the shocks of the trade period, with the 24-year-old contracted until the end of 2022.
On Wednesday, Dogs coach Luke Beveridge said Dunkley wasnt at his best and faced pressure for his spot, something he responded to on SEN Drive.
